自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 资源 (2)
  • 收藏
  • 关注

原创 monkey 基础语法

1.检查adb 环境 adb verison ,展示对应信息,则表示环境可用2.安装apkadb install <apk文件路径>3.查看设备:adb devices,展示设别信息,说明设备可用4.查看设备失败,尝试重启设备杀掉 adb kill-server 重启 adb start-sever5.获取设备信息成功,查看对应的测试apk 包名,拿到自己的需要测试的包名 adb shell #cddata/data #lsmonkey 基本参数

2021-09-06 13:36:35 3096

转载 测试 之 持续集成

http://www.51testing.com/html/61/n-3726661.html

2021-09-06 11:15:58 98

转载 移动端的apple支付测试方法

https://blog.csdn.net/julius_lee/article/details/108508963

2021-07-29 11:03:20 314

原创 性能测试的具体流程概括

上一期 写了性能调优的基本手段, 对于高阶 性能测试人员。 那对于基础或者初入性能测试的人员来说,重要的还是整个性能测试的思路的。 如下是用比较接底气的方式总结了 性能测试过程中的一个流程需求分析,场景设计,制定性能指标 需求分析设计需求来源, 运营+ 商务 + 产品 一起协商。 场景设计则区分 是新项目上线时还是项目已经在线上运行,新项目上线则是大家凭借个人经验 推测而来。项目已经上线的话,可以统计线上用户的操作来分析具体的场景数据。 性能指标则 需要根据现有环境跟运维或者研发同事

2021-07-29 10:50:59 90

原创 RobotFramework 的 关键字

RobotFramework带有丰富的系统关键,使用时无需导入,直接使用,为写自动化用例带来了极大的方便。 当说到关键字时一时会搞不清楚具体 是指什么。 那如下讲解一下 RF的关键字分类,常见的 分为用户关键字也就是自定义关键字,还有 RF内置的关键字,和第三方库。 他们主要是根据关键字具体的功能份分类。 内置关键字最典型的是 断言关键字,后面会举例说明。 其他的关键字在需要在用的时候去了解。自定义关键字ride 可添加 user keyword 就是自定义关键字,根据自己的需要定义具体的...

2021-07-07 11:33:24 492

原创 性能调优常规手段

性能调优就是用更少的资源提供更好的服务,成本利益最大化。性能调优的手段并不新鲜,性能调优常规手段有:(1)空间换时间,内存、缓存就是典型的空间换时间的例子。利用内存缓存从磁盘上取出的数据,CPU请求数据直接从内存中获取,从而获取比从磁盘读取数据更高的效率。(2)时间换空间,当空间成为瓶颈时,切分数据分批次处理,用更少的空间完成任务处理。上传大附件时经常用这种方式。(3)分而治之,把任务切分,分开执行,也方便并行执行来提高效率。(4)异步处理,业务链路上有任务时间消耗较长,可以拆分业务,减少阻塞影响。

2021-07-05 16:33:42 295

原创 全局埋点 SDK 测试用例

2021-07-05 11:04:03 640

原创 web 端的爬虫

对于网络爬虫,找准需要抓取的内容位置是首先遇到的问题。新闻资讯类的网站,由于需要快速被搜索引擎搜索到,所以要抓取的内容90%都会在Doc里,不在Doc再去XHR里查找,最后去JS里查找。如果响应内容在Doc里,一般在html请求的Response里可以查找到网页元素;如果在XHR和JS里,则需要在Preview的result里查找,一般为json格式,需要import json,通过json.laods方法将抓取的数据存到字典里。如一个评论数通过一个js来计算获取,通过查找js,发现Headers里的

2021-06-30 15:37:08 264

原创 andorid8以上无法转到https 的包

andorid 系统大于8的,如果不改配置信息无法装包的话,可以考虑在移动端安装一个虚拟机,下载地址:https://github.com/android-hacker/VirtualXposed/releases/tag/0.20.2

2021-06-30 15:34:36 43

原创 fillder证书 重新生成

会遇到 证书始终错误,如果不是私钥的问题, 可以尝试一下重新安装pc端的证书http://www.telerik.com/docs/default-source/fiddler/addons/fiddlercertmaker.exe?sfvrsn=2

2021-06-30 15:32:22 175

原创 Mongo 基本命令

1、Help查看命令提示helpdb.help();db.yourColl.help();db.youColl.find().help();rs.help();2、切换/创建数据库useyourDB; 当创建一个集合(table)的时候会自动创建当前数据库3、查询所有数据库showdbs;4、删除当前使用数据库db.dropDatabase();5、从指定主机上克隆数据库db.cloneDatabase(“127.0.0.1”);将指定机器上的数据库的数据克隆到当前数据库6、从

2021-06-30 14:00:39 464

原创 robotframework + python部署

robotframework 断言关键字https://www.cnblogs.com/xiaozhaoboke/p/11434874.htmlrobotframework 数据库关键字http://www.voidcn.com/article/p-diysnbgs-kd.htmlhttps://www.cnblogs.com/laoqing/p/8542487.htmlrobotframework ifhttps://www.cnblogs.com/kelly11/p/12696048.h

2021-06-29 17:27:32 158

原创 Jmeter+Jenkins+Ant 接口自动化持续集成框架

前言:首先简单说下jmeter+jenkins+ant接口自动化持续集成框架的工作原理,以便于更好的理解后面的各项配置:首先,jenkins通过SVN获取jmeter最新的脚本;然后,jenkins通过ANT进行构建,构建时ANT首先去找构建的配置文件,通过配置文件找到需要执行jmeter脚本。执行完jmeter脚本后会生成jtl报告文件;接着,ANT会根据构建的配置文件中指定的测试报告模版,把jtl文件转换成HTML测试报告;最后,通过jenkins在构建完成后发送邮件,邮件中包含每次转换后的H

2021-06-29 11:17:45 623

原创 移动APP研发流程

研发项目流程管理,常见的V 或者敏捷,或者在这这二者基础上根据公司的习惯自然而然的出现的一种流程。 同理在各大公司里,每一个角色的细微分工也有不同, 如下图的大致信息, 涵盖的是主要职责图片来自 【移动APP测试实战】一书中工作流程如下: 更多提现的是瀑布模型...

2021-06-28 10:55:35 79

软件测试过程与策略第二章.ppt

在软件测试过程中,对于不同项目周期以及计划对应的策略

2021-04-09

敏捷开发项目流程介绍,什么是敏捷开发

敏捷开发

2021-04-09

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除